| Services | Working with at-risk youth age 0-17. |
| Eligibility | Youth and their families are eligible for services who meet one of the
following criteria: 1: Runaway Youth-a youth who has left home without parental permission or who has no identification or residence. Youth whose parents or caretakers have told them to leave or who have consented to conflict. 2. Truant Youth- a youth who has been voluntarily absent from school for reasons other than those approved by the school where he/she is enrolled. 3. Youth in family conflict- A youth and/or family who request services as a result of significant family youth. 4. Delinquent youth-Youth ages 7-9 who are involved in delinquent offences. Youth ages 10-16 who are involved in misdemeanor offenses and state jail felonies. |
| Application |
Contact the STAR program by calling 1-800-256-7696. |
| Cost of Services |
None. Program funded by TDFPS. |
